Revamped Tachikawa Public Relations Paper Introduces Stylish New Look
Tachikawa City has officially announced a major redesign of its public relations paper, "Kohō Tachikawa," starting from the September 10 edition. With a new design implemented for the first time in 12 years, the publication aims to offer a modern aesthetic and enhanced readability for its residents.
Key Features of the Redesign
The redesign addresses several critical areas:
- - Enhanced Readability: In the previous format, the publication had both vertical and horizontal text, which made it somewhat confusing for readers. The new edition has standardized the text layout to horizontal reading throughout, which is generally quicker and easier to understand. Additionally, the layout will now open from the left, making it more user-friendly.
- - Modern Aesthetic: The old design had remained unchanged for over a decade, losing its appeal over time. The new layout is sleek and contemporary, fitting the current era. It employs elegant English fonts that are particularly appealing to younger readers, encouraging them to engage with the content.
An eye-catching cover featuring children from the after-school program “Kurupure” jumping joyfully was chosen for the September 10 issue. This dynamic imagery aims to attract attention, making it a publication that residents will want to pick up and read.
Overview of "Kohō Tachikawa"
The public relations paper caters to the residents of Tachikawa with valuable information and updates. Here are some details about the publication:
- - Name: Kohō Tachikawa
- - Format: Tabloid size, 12 pages, color printing
- - Distribution: Approximately 100,000 copies are printed per issue, leading to about 2.37 million copies annually. It is published bi-monthly on the 10th and 25th of each month, ensuring residents stay informed.
- - Delivery: Copies are distributed door-to-door in the city as well as placed in public facilities.
- - Accessibility: For individuals with visual impairments, an audio version titled “Voice Kohō” is recorded and distributed, ensuring that all residents can access the information included.
